I have two bracelets and they're half-Pandora, half-other-stuff. The other stuff includes charms from Jovana, Redbalifrog and muranos from Etsy artists. I'd post a photo but my camera doesn't take good close-ups of jewelry. Some time ago there were others in this thread who posted photos of gorgeous bracelets that included charms from Chamilia.
Charms from other brands can potentially damage the Pandora bracelet if their hole is tight and they get stuck on or scratch the threaded segments. I've never experienced any problems in that regard.
Some of the glass beads I've bought from Etsy artists and some of the Redbalifrog silvers are larger than the Pandora charms and they feel a bit bulky on my wrist. I like the bright, artsy look of the bracelets with these charms. But I find the bracelet that is mostly Pandora charms to be the most comfortable one to wear, as the beads are small, rounded and evenly sized if this makes sense. It feels smoother and more unobtrusive on my wrist than the bracelet with the large, unevenly sized charms.
From what I've read Ohm Beads tend to be evenly sized with Pandora charms.
